Presented below are three revenue recognition situations. (a) Groupo sells goods to MTN for $919,000, payment due at delivery. (

b) Groupo sells goods on account to Grifols for $770,000, payment due in 30 days. (c) Groupo sells goods to Magnus for $483,000, payment due in two installments, the first installment payable in 18 months and the second payment due 6 months later. The present value of the future payments is $443,700.

Answer:

Find below the requirement of the question:

Indicate the transaction price for each of these transactions and when revenue will be recognized.

1.At the time of delivery-$919,000

2 At the time of delivery-$770,000

3.At the time of delivery-$443,700

Explanation:

Generally speaking, from IFRS and U.S GAAP standpoint,revenue should be recognized when the seller has delivered goods to the customer or when services  have been rendered,in essence the revenue recognition time is at the time of delivery for the three situations.

However,the amount to be recognized differs from one situation to the other,hence $919,000 should be recognized in the first instance and $770,000 in the second situation.

Finally,only the present value or present worth is recognized in the third situation as that reflect the fair value  of goods sold.

Interdependence results from:
artcher [175]

Answer:

<h2><u>promotive interaction </u></h2>

Explanation:

Positive interdependence (cooperation) results in promotive interaction where individuals encourage and facilitate teammates' efforts to complete the task. Negative interdependence (competition) encourages contrient interaction where team members work to oppose or block the success of others on their team while working to further their own, individual goals.
